Typical Applications
Medical: Hospital oxygen supply systems
Manufacturing: Cutting, brazing, welding, heat treatment and chemical oxidation processes
Environmental: Feed gas for ozone generators, environmental remediation and wastewater treatment
Glass: Glass processing, manufacturing and blowing processes
Aquaculture: Provide oxygen for fish farming
1. How does the PSA oxygen generator work?
The selective adsorption characteristics of the adsorbent on gases at different pressures are used to separate oxygen and nitrogen from the air. Oxygen is extracted by adsorbing oxygen from the air at high pressure and then releasing it at low pressure in a cycle.

5. What are the environmental operating conditions of the equipment?
Place in a well-ventilated, weather-protected area, and maintain operating temperatures between 40°F (4°C) and 104°F (40°C) to ensure proper operation of the equipment.
6. What are the feed air requirements?
Feed air should be clean, dry "plant air" meeting ISO 8573.1 Class 5.6.5, with a minimum pressure of 90 psig (621 kPa) and a maximum temperature of 122°F (50°C).
